Nuns on the run
Three nuns were stopped for doing 120mph in their Ford Fiesta on the way to see the Pope
The nuns told officers that they were rushing to check on Pope Benedict XVI’s home after hearing that he had fallen over and injured his wrist. The driver, Sister Tavoletta, was fined £325 and banned for a month. She will try and appeal the decision.
